Proceeding contribution from David TC Davies (Conservative) in the House of Commons on Tuesday, 18 July 2006. It occurred during Debate on bill on Government of Wales Bill.
Government of Wales Bill
Thank you, Madam Deputy Speaker. I am not going to talk about the No. 73 omnibus that runs between Chepstow and Cwmbran, because that one is disappearing as well. But the fact is that nobody on any of the few omnibuses that are left in Wales is talking about the need to change the PR system in the way that this Government propose. Tonight, they want to use their majority to push through a profoundly undemocratic change to the electoral system. I urge those decent members of the Labour party to forget about their party Whips, for once, to think about what is good for democracy in Wales, to reject what their Government are trying to do, and to support the Lords amendments tonight.
